The art insurance questionnaire is designed to gather specific information about your artworks, including their provenance, value, condition, and storage location. By providing accurate and detailed information, you can help insurance companies assess the risk associated with insuring your art collection. This information is critical in determining the coverage limits, premiums, and terms of the insurance policy. Incomplete or inaccurate information can lead to potential gaps in coverage or disputes during the claims process.
One of the key benefits of filling out an art insurance questionnaire is that it allows you to establish the value of your art collection. Providing detailed information about each artwork, including the artist, title, medium, size, provenance, and purchase price, can help insurance companies determine the replacement value of your artworks. This is essential in ensuring that you have adequate coverage to replace or repair your artworks in the event of damage or loss.
Moreover, the art insurance questionnaire can also help you assess the condition of your artworks and identify any potential risks or vulnerabilities. By providing information about how your artworks are stored, displayed, and maintained, you can take proactive measures to mitigate risks such as theft, fire, water damage, or environmental hazards. Insurance companies may also require you to take certain security measures or preventive actions to reduce the likelihood of damage or loss to your art collection.
In addition, filling out an art insurance questionnaire can help you navigate the complexities of insurance coverage and policy terms. Insurance companies may ask specific questions about your art collection, such as whether you loan your artworks to exhibitions, transport them frequently, or store them in multiple locations. By providing accurate information, you can ensure that your insurance policy covers all the risks associated with your art collection and includes any additional endorsements or riders that may be necessary.
Furthermore, the art insurance questionnaire serves as a valuable record of your art collection, including detailed descriptions, appraisals, and photographs of each artwork. This documentation can be crucial in the event of a claim, as it provides evidence of the existence, condition, and value of your artworks. Keeping an updated inventory of your art collection can also help you track any changes or additions to your collection over time and ensure that your insurance coverage remains up to date.
